EA Sports FC 27 introduces a major reinvention for the franchise with the addition of The Grounds, an online open-world social hub designed to blend traditional football gameplay with street-level action and cultural exploration. Led by line producer Karthik Venkateshan and game design director Jean-Francois Guastalla, the mode marks the first time EA Sports has introduced a dedicated 3D social space for the world's popular sport, comparable to similar hub environments seen in basketball and wrestling titles.

The Three Districts of The Grounds

The map is divided into three distinct districts, each modeled after a real-world location to provide an authentic window into local football communities. Montclair channels the streets of Paris, Zeiza reflects Buenos Aires, and Parkside reimagines suburban Britain, complete with community murals and local landmarks like the Nutmeg cafe. Each district serves as an interactive mini football museum where players can approach interactable icons to learn about football history and players associated with the region.

Match Types and Kickabouts

Central to the hub is the Terrace, where up to 100 players spawn into a session before heading to their customized clubhouses or out onto the streets. Architectural styles on the map hint at the game modes housed within them, ranging from red-brick grounds for classic 11v11 matches to metallic buildings for Rush.

At release, players can access four distinct small-sided world-based experiences: 1v1, 2v2, 3v3, and standard 5v5 Rush. In addition, party-game-style Kickabouts are scattered across the map. Four Kickabouts are available at launch:

  • Goal Control: Compete against another opponent across eight goals positioned around the edge of the pitch to secure the majority.
  • The Big Race: A dribbling obstacle course featuring moving training equipment.
  • Bucket Ball: A blend of basketball and football where 2v2 teams score points in hoops above.
  • Balloon Ball: A dodgeball-inspired mode where kicking the ball at players pops three balloons hanging over their heads.

Drop Kick Targets are also placed throughout the environment in council flat windows, fences, and floating mid-air for players to collect while exploring.

Progression, Mentors, and Amps

Players create and customize a footballer, exploring the world to earn new skills, cosmetics, and permanent stat progression through challenges and master archetypes. Respeccing characters is available for free.

To aid progression, world-famous football stars act as in-game mentors. Kylian Mbappe, Paulo Dybala, Chloe Kelly, and Alex Hunter share stories of their playing days and offer challenges that help players develop their skills.

For short-term boosts, players can utilize Amps, a new consumable system. Equipping up to three Amps at a time grants temporary attribute boosts, perks, and playstyles. Standard and signature variants exist, with signature Amps tied to real-world players like Mbappe—granting specific bonuses such as increased shooting and strength for five matches. Amps are primarily earned through objectives, live events, campaigns, and season progression, or purchased through the store.

Seasonal Updates and Store Content

The store features a wide array of cosmetic items, including sportswear, matchday streetwear, replica shirts, and branded apparel from Nike, Adidas, Puma, and New Balance.

The live environment updates across 10 scheduled seasons throughout the year. Confirmed seasonal themes include European Nights focusing on the Champions League in October, Screaming Grounds for Halloween in November, Thunder Struck for Black Friday, Frozen Grounds for winter snow in December, and Team of the Year in January.
